<!-- Make sure you've read the CONTRIBUTING.md guidelines: https://github.com/stack-auth/stack-auth/blob/dev/CONTRIBUTING.md --> <!-- RECURSEML_SUMMARY:START --> ## High-level PR Summary This PR adds a new `priceId` field to the `OneTimePurchase` and `Subscription` models in the database to store Stripe price identifiers. The change includes database schema updates, corresponding migration files, and modifications to payment processing logic to properly track and store price IDs throughout the purchase flow. Stack Auth: Open-source Clerk/Auth0 alternative
📘 Docs | ☁️ Hosted Version | ✨ Demo | 🎮 Discord | GitHub
Stack Auth is a managed user authentication solution. It is developer-friendly and fully open-source (licensed under MIT and AGPL).
Stack Auth gets you started in just five minutes, after which you'll be ready to use all of its features as you grow your project. Our managed service is completely optional and you can export your user data and self-host, for free, at any time.
We support Next.js frontends, along with any backend that can use our REST API. Check out our setup guide to get started.
📦 Installation & Setup
- Run Stack Auth's installation wizard with the following command:
npx @stackframe/init-stack@latest - Then, create an account on the Stack Auth dashboard, create a new project with an API key, and copy its environment variables into the .env.local file of your Next.js project:
NEXT_PUBLIC_STACK_PROJECT_ID=<your-project-id> NEXT_PUBLIC_STACK_PUBLISHABLE_CLIENT_KEY=<your-publishable-client-key> STACK_SECRET_SERVER_KEY=<your-secret-server-key> - That's it! You can run your app with
npm run devand go to http://localhost:3000/handler/signup to see the sign-up page. You can also check out the account settings page at http://localhost:3000/handler/account-settings.
Check out the documentation for a more detailed guide.
